WebOct 20, 2024 · Unplug and cool the iron. Fill a shallow pan with ice cubes and place the melted plastic-stained part of the iron on the ice. Let it sit for five to 10 minutes to harden … WebMethod 1: Treat Iron Stains with Lemon Juice, Salt, Water and Vinegar. This easy method for removing iron stains on clothes requires inexpensive materials you can find in the grocery store. Here’s how to do it: Sprinkle salt and squeeze a little lemon juice onto the stained areas. Leave the item of clothing out to dry in the sun for half an hour.

Iron on labels are an excellent option if you are trying to order labels for garments you are selling in your … link and linkin parkWebHow to Get Ironing Board Marks Out of Clothes One solution would be to use the steam function on your iron and steam the marks out. The hot steam, if the fabric allows the heat, should loosen the fibers and help get those marks out.
